当Redis的哨兵选举出新的主节点后,它会执行以下操作:

  1. 将新的主节点的地址和其他从节点的地址更新到所有哨兵的配置中,以便它们能够知道新的主节点的位置。
  2. 哨兵会向所有从节点发送命令,让它们重新配置自己,将新的主节点设置为它们的主服务器,并开始复制新的主服务器的数据。
  3. 哨兵会向客户端发送一个特殊的命令,告诉它们新的主节点的地址,以便客户端可以更新自己的配置,并开始向新的主节点发送命令。
  4. 哨兵会监控新的主节点的运行情况,如果发现主节点出现故障,它会重新发起选举,选出一个新的主节点。
  5. 如果有更多的从节点加入到Redis集群中,哨兵会监控它们的运行情况,并在需要时进行故障转移。

总之,哨兵选主成功后,它会更新配置、通知从节点和客户端、监控主节点,并在需要时重新发起选举或进行故障转移。这样可以确保Redis集群的高可用性和持久性。

redis哨兵选主成功后会进行什么操作?

原文地址: http://www.cveoy.top/t/topic/iySO 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录